American Icon: Alan Mulally and the Fight to Save Ford Motor Company

  • 14h 46m 4s
  • Bryce G. Hoffman
  • Recorded Books, Inc.
  • 2012

A riveting, behind-the-scenes account of the near collapse of the Ford Motor Company, which in 2008 was close to bankruptcy, and CEO Alan Mulally's hard-fought effort and bold plan—including his decision not to take federal bailout money—to bring Ford back from the brink.
